Fisheries independent trawl survey data of fish biomass on North American and European oceanic shelves.
<p>Publicly available scientific bottom trawl survey data, primarily sampling demersal commercial species, were obtained from the Northeast Pacific and North Atlantic shelf regions in 2021. The final dataset contains approx. 197,000 unique tows and includes data from 1970 to 2019 (166,000 tows between 1980-2015). For each tow in each survey, we selected all teleost and elasmobranch species and obtained species weight. We corrected these weights for differences in sampling area (in km2) and trawl gear catchability.</p> <p>The data processing scripts and individual survey data can be found on Github (DOI: 10.5281/zenodo.7992482). The data processing scripts are modified based on earlier work from Pinsky et al. (2013) and Maureaud et al. (2019).</p> <p>If the correction for gear catchability is not important, it is recommended to use the FishGlob database (DOI: 10.5281/zenodo.7484547).</p> <p>Please contact Daniel van Denderen (pdvd@aqua.dtu.dk) for questions.</p> <p><strong>Column names</strong><br> Haul_id: unique haul identifyer<br> Survey_Region: survey name or name of ecoregion (depending on survey)<br> Gear: gear information (only included for northeast Atlantic region). Gear information is available for other regions. See original survey description (sources in manuscript).<br> Year: sampling year<br> Month: sampling month<br> Longitude: longitude (EPSG:4326)<br> Latitude: latitude (EPSG:4326)<br> Swept_area: estimate of swept area of survey gear (only included for northeast Atlantic region)<br> Bottom_depth: bottom depth in meters (as recorded in the survey data)<br> Family: taxonomic family of the teleost/elasmobranch<br> Name: species name (or higher taxonomic grouping)<br> kg_km2: wet weight (kilogram) per unit of swept area (km2)<br> kg_km2_corrected: wet weight (kilogram) per unit of swept area (km2) corrected for trawl gear catchability<br> F_type: fish type (demersal or pelagic)<br> Trophic_lev: Species-specific trophic level information</p> <p><br> <strong>Data uncertainties</strong><br> Data have predominantly been analysed at the community level and between 1980 and 2015. Any species-specific inferences may need further checking.</p> <p>To reduce the effect of potential outlying biomass estimates, it is recommended to remove all individual observations 1.5 times less/greater than the interquantile range per survey and year based on log10-transformed biomass values.</p> <p>Please contact Daniel van Denderen (pdvd@aqua.dtu.dk) for any comments/questions.</p>

Dataset of EMBCP survey results: Ocean experts (2020)
<p>In order to provide a picture of marine science communication in Europe being presented at the European Marine Board Future Science Brief N°8 ‘<a href="https://www.marineboard.eu/publications/marine-science-communication-europe-way-forward">Marine Science Communication in Europe: a way forward</a>’, the European Marine Board Communications Panel (EMCP) carried out three surveys targeting different stakeholder groups from across Europe. The results of these surveys underpin this document. Two main, in-depth surveys were carried out, one targeting experts (Ocean scientists, marine policy-makers, industry representatives, media professionals and Ocean communication or education experts) and the other targeting secondary-school students (17-18 years old). This dataset presents the results of the survey targeting experts.</p>

Airgun-ocean bottom seismometer survey dataset
<p>These data are the seismic waveform recordsections and the P-wave velocity model obtained by Azuma et al. (JGR, 2018), collected through an airgun-ocean bottom seismometer (OBS) survey.</p> <p>The recordsections of 29 OBS are 'RAW data' with no waveform procedure and are formatted in SEG-Y. Length of each trace is 60 seconds. Offset ranges, distances along the survey line, position of each shot and OBS, are included in header.</p> <p>The final velocity data is written in netCDF.</p>

Ocean bottom seismometer survey line OBS2016-2 across the magnetic quiet zone and continent-ocean boundary in the northeastern South China Sea
<p>OBS2016-2 dataset was collect in July, 2016. The ~320 km long NW-SE oriented profile OBS2016-2 is located to the east of the Dongsha Islands, extending from the Chaoshan Depression to the East Subbasin of the South China Sea. Seismic data were collected by R/V Shiyan-2 of South China Sea Institute of Oceanology (SCSIO), Chinese Academy of Science. The seismic sources are composed of four large volume Bolt airguns and the total airgun volume is 6000 in3. The firing interval was 90 s in time and 204 meters in distance, and the sailing speed of R/V Shiyan-2 was about 4.5 knots during the experiment. A total of 1572 shots were fired. Fifteen 4-component broadband OBSs were deployed, and fourteen of them were retrieved successfully with good data records. Data format is SAC.</p>
